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
20071727850 5632180375 80746406529 67
7944671670 59501690 83
7944671670 59501690 83
2651634 4129625 6706858052
All about undefined
Interested in learning more?
7944671670 59501690 83
2651634 4129625 6706858052
See more
3472 850 18879935274
29793664 25 797331 74950
See more
4643 18
89046 026433075 7315826425
See more